Shifamed
Senior Firmware Engineer
Apply for the Sr. Firmware Engineer position at Shifamed.
Base Pay Range $135,000.00/yr - $175,000.00/yr
About Shifamed Founded in 2009 by serial entrepreneur Amr Salahieh, Shifamed LLC is a privately held medical device innovation hub focused on the development of novel medical products addressing clinical needs in cardiology and ophthalmology.
Role Overview As a Senior Firmware Engineer, you will design, develop, and test embedded software for medical devices. You will work on bare‑metal firmware and real‑time operating systems (RTOS) to ensure reliable and safe device performance. This role requires strong technical expertise, attention to detail, and a passion for meeting stringent regulatory and clinical requirements.
Responsibilities
Design and develop embedded firmware for medical devices, including bare‑metal and RTOS‑based systems.
Participate in cross‑functional teams to develop, verify, and validate product designs through all phases of development.
Define firmware requirements from system and user needs and develop methods to resolve technical challenges.
Implement and optimize low‑level drivers, communication protocols, and hardware interfaces.
Collaborate with hardware, software, and systems engineers to ensure seamless integration.
Develop and execute unit tests, integration tests, and system‑level verification for firmware components.
Document design, implementation, and testing activities in compliance with regulatory standards.
Support risk analysis, design reviews, and regulatory submissions.
Troubleshoot and resolve firmware‑related issues during development and testing phases.
Education & Work Experience
Bachelor’s degree in Electrical, Computer Engineering, or related field; Master’s preferred.
5+ years of embedded firmware experience.
Proficient in C/C++ embedded programming, bare‑metal development, and at least one RTOS (e.g., FreeRTOS, ThreadX, QNX).
Strong understanding of microcontrollers, hardware interfaces, and communication protocols (SPI, I2C, UART, CAN, USB).
Experience delivering firmware for regulated products, preferably medical devices, with familiarity in IEC 62304.
Skilled with debugging tools, version control (Git), and supporting regulatory documentation.
Preferred Qualifications
Experience with wireless communication protocols (Bluetooth, Wi‑Fi).
Familiarity with cybersecurity principles for embedded systems.
Knowledge of scripting languages (Python, Bash) for automation and testing.
Experience with bootloaders and secure firmware update mechanisms.
Exposure to power management techniques for embedded systems.
Hands‑on experience with hardware bring‑up and board‑level troubleshooting.
Notice to Candidates Shifamed and its portfolio companies do not conduct interviews or extend offers through mobile web chat applications. Please report any such occurrences to hr@shifamed.com.
Seniority Level Mid‑Senior level
Employment Type Full‑time
Job Function Engineering and Information Technology
Industry Medical Equipment Manufacturing
Location and Salary San Jose, CA – $135,000.00–$175,000.00 + equity + benefits
#J-18808-Ljbffr
Base Pay Range $135,000.00/yr - $175,000.00/yr
About Shifamed Founded in 2009 by serial entrepreneur Amr Salahieh, Shifamed LLC is a privately held medical device innovation hub focused on the development of novel medical products addressing clinical needs in cardiology and ophthalmology.
Role Overview As a Senior Firmware Engineer, you will design, develop, and test embedded software for medical devices. You will work on bare‑metal firmware and real‑time operating systems (RTOS) to ensure reliable and safe device performance. This role requires strong technical expertise, attention to detail, and a passion for meeting stringent regulatory and clinical requirements.
Responsibilities
Design and develop embedded firmware for medical devices, including bare‑metal and RTOS‑based systems.
Participate in cross‑functional teams to develop, verify, and validate product designs through all phases of development.
Define firmware requirements from system and user needs and develop methods to resolve technical challenges.
Implement and optimize low‑level drivers, communication protocols, and hardware interfaces.
Collaborate with hardware, software, and systems engineers to ensure seamless integration.
Develop and execute unit tests, integration tests, and system‑level verification for firmware components.
Document design, implementation, and testing activities in compliance with regulatory standards.
Support risk analysis, design reviews, and regulatory submissions.
Troubleshoot and resolve firmware‑related issues during development and testing phases.
Education & Work Experience
Bachelor’s degree in Electrical, Computer Engineering, or related field; Master’s preferred.
5+ years of embedded firmware experience.
Proficient in C/C++ embedded programming, bare‑metal development, and at least one RTOS (e.g., FreeRTOS, ThreadX, QNX).
Strong understanding of microcontrollers, hardware interfaces, and communication protocols (SPI, I2C, UART, CAN, USB).
Experience delivering firmware for regulated products, preferably medical devices, with familiarity in IEC 62304.
Skilled with debugging tools, version control (Git), and supporting regulatory documentation.
Preferred Qualifications
Experience with wireless communication protocols (Bluetooth, Wi‑Fi).
Familiarity with cybersecurity principles for embedded systems.
Knowledge of scripting languages (Python, Bash) for automation and testing.
Experience with bootloaders and secure firmware update mechanisms.
Exposure to power management techniques for embedded systems.
Hands‑on experience with hardware bring‑up and board‑level troubleshooting.
Notice to Candidates Shifamed and its portfolio companies do not conduct interviews or extend offers through mobile web chat applications. Please report any such occurrences to hr@shifamed.com.
Seniority Level Mid‑Senior level
Employment Type Full‑time
Job Function Engineering and Information Technology
Industry Medical Equipment Manufacturing
Location and Salary San Jose, CA – $135,000.00–$175,000.00 + equity + benefits
#J-18808-Ljbffr